Wall Street JournalU.S. To Forgive Corinthian Student LoansRTT NewsThe U.S. Department of Education has forgiven federal loans provided to tens of thousands of students enrolled at for-profit college Corinthian Colleges, Inc. (COCO). The school filed for Chapter 11 bankruptcy in early May amid charges of fraud.
